Trusted for over 100 years
Weleda are one of the most trusted natural skin care brands in the world, and they’ve been trusted in the market for over 100 years now. Here’s what sets them apart from other brands you might find on the shelf in a chemist, a supermarket or even a department store.
- 100% certified natural by NATRUE, the first internationally recognised quality seal for natural cosmetics
- Free from mineral oils, parabens, silicones and PEGs
- GMO free, microplastic free
- Absolutely no animal testing
- 80% of the botanical ingredients are certified organic
- Ingredient sourcing is done ethically and with respect for biodiversity

Is Weleda vegan?
Some of the Weleda range is vegan, but not all of it. A small selection of their products contain Beeswax (Cera Alba), including the original Skin Food, Skin Food Light & Skin Food Lip Balm. The Body Lotion, Body Butter and the Face range in Skin Food are all vegan. Check the ingredients on other products including the hand creams for hydrolyzed beeswax.
About Weleda’s packaging & recycling program
Weleda encourages their customers to keep all recyclable packaging from Weleda products and they can be sent back to them directly to be recycled through the TerraCycle program. They ask that you wait until you have a box full and then Weleda can be contacted directly for a free reply paid address to return the empty packaging to them.
Across the whole range, approx 60% of the products are packaged in recycled glass, 15% aluminium and the rest is plastic. Each material has a list of pro’s and con’s. While glass can be recycled endlessly with no quality loss, it’s heavier (giving a higher CO2 consumption during transport and might break. Aluminium has a lot of pluses but the production of it uses a lot of energy and the tubes can break at the creases. With the TerraCycle recycling scheme mentioned above, Weleda are using more recycled plastic in their plastic packing materials
